In 2001, Robert Pickton was charged with murdering 26 women at his pig farm in Port Coquitlam , BC. He was convicted on six charges and sentenced to life in prison. Pickton claimed to have killed 49 women. His case was the largest serial killer investigation in Canadian history.Yes, Robert Pickton is still alive and remains in prison in Canada. Even if Pickton is released …Oct 15, 2022 · Robert William “Willy” Pickton was charged with murdering 26 women. He was convicted of six counts and sentenced to life in prison. In a jail cell conversation, he told an undercover police officer that he had killed 49 people. He was planning to kill one more and then take a break before continuing.
